After profitable in final week’s election with a promise to push again in opposition to U.S. President Donald Trump’s commerce and sovereignty threats, Canadian Prime Minister Mark Carney had his first high-stakes assembly with Trump on the White Home on Tuesday.
In entrance of the cameras within the Oval Workplace, the 2 males appeared pleasant, with no signal of the form of animus seen throughout the now-infamous dustup between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ky and the U.S. president in that very same room again in February. However though Trump congratulated Carney on his victory and insisted that “no matter something, we’re going to be mates with Canada,” neither aspect appeared keen to make speedy concessions to enhance the 2 nations’ quickly deteriorating bilateral relations.
On the prime of the agenda was the U.S. commerce battle on Canada. Since taking workplace, Trump has imposed a slew of tariffs on Canadian items, together with steel and aluminum. When requested by a reporter if there may be something that Carney can say right now to vary Trump’s thoughts, Trump remained absolute: “No. That’s the best way it’s.”
Among the many most inflammatory statements of Tuesday’s Oval Workplace assembly, although, have been the 2 leaders’ feedback on Canadian sovereignty. Trump reiterated that he nonetheless needs to make Canada the 51st U.S. state. He burdened his historical past as an actual property developer, referred to the U.S.-Canada border as an “artificially drawn line,” and joked about his previous conduct of referring to former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au as “governor.”
In response, Carney doubled down on his opposition to Canadian statehood. “As you understand from actual property, there are some locations which might be by no means on the market,” Carney instructed Trump, including that Ottawa is “not on the market. It received’t be on the market, ever.”
“By no means say by no means” was Trump’s response.
